“KING OF PASTRY” JACQUY PFEIFFER TO PROVIDE GEORGE BROWN CHEF SCHOOLSTUDENTS WITH EXCLUSIVE TORONTO LESSON IN “SUGAR PULLING” 

Chef from the critically acclaimed documentary “Kings of Pastry” and The French Pastry School in Chicago to demonstrate techniques to George Brown Chef School pastry students

 

TORONTO (March 30, 2011) – On Friday, April 1, one of the world’s best known pastry chefs, Chef Jacquy Pfeiffer of the French Pastry School in Chicago, will be at the George Brown Chef School to provide an exclusive lesson for the college’s pastry students. Media are invited to attend this special opportunity, which will include a pulled sugar demonstration and a question and answer period.

In May 2010, Chef Pfeiffer appeared in “Kings of Pastry,” a documentary that followed his journey before and during the prestigious 2009 “Meilleurs Ouvriers de France” competition (Best Craftsmen in France) in Pastry. Chef Pfeiffer is also known for The French Pastry School in Chicago, an institution he co-founded with fellow pastry chef Sebastien Caronne in 1995.

WHAT:   An exclusive pastry demonstration for students of the George Brown Chef School. Chef Pfeiffer will demonstrate sugar pulling for the students and will then open the floor to questions.

WHO:     Chef Jacquy Pfeiffer, co-founder of The French Pastry School in Chicago and one of the pastry chefs featured in the critically acclaimed documentary, “Kings of Pastry.”

About George Brown College

Toronto’s George Brown College has established a reputation for equipping students with the skills, industry experience and credentials to pursue the careers of their choice. From its two main campuses located across the downtown core, George Brown offers 148 full-time and 1,600 continuing education programs across a wide variety of professions to a student body of approximately 63,000 (including those enrolled in full-time, part-time and continuing education programs). Students can earn diplomas, post-graduate certificates, industry accreditations, apprenticeships and four-year bachelor degrees.
